My guest in this episode is Moritz Waldstein-Wartenberg of Mitte from Berlin, Germany.
We all drink water, mostly, I guess. I drink it in my tea, usually Fennel Anis Cumin bio tea, I drink it many times per day. Or I consume water in its pure form. But is water really pure? If it’s not pure, for example tap water, which we drink many times in Europe, how do you make sure you have a high quality water at home without going to the supermarket, paying for it and without taking, then throwing out the plastic bottles? And if you get it in the supermarket, is that good enough water for us?
Mitte addresses these points mentioned. With Moritz we talked about different technologies to purify water, how Mitte started out, the milestones they reached and how they got to the current investment round of 10 million. We also covered some of the strategies and tactics they used. We also touched on agile transformation, a topic covered in the last episode.
